Bike for Heroes Ride

This is a non Club Event

Participation is at your own risk. STLRC assumes no liability.

August 19, 2023 @ 8:00 am – 2:00 pm

Please consider joining Joan Fromme, and Faye Holdenried on a non-club charity ride to support our veterans.  The Joshua Chamberlain Society is having their 8th Annual Bike for Heroes Charity Ride on Saturday, August 19, 2023 starting in Columbia, Ill.  We will be doing the 50 mile flat ride averaging 10-12 mph but there are many other choices of mileages and speeds.

Money provides long-term support to veterans from local areas that have sustained permanent combat injuries fighting the long war on terror for our nation.  It also provides long-term support to the children of veterans who have made the ultimate sacrifice in our serve.

Starting Location:  Sunset Overlook Restaurant, 11604 Bluff Road Columbia Illinois.

Arrival Time:  8:00 am  (If you wish to ride on your own, you can select your own time to begin.  The event starts at 6:00 am.  There are routes that vary from 10 to 100 miles.)

Start Time: 8:15 am

Description:  Tour the flat farmlands of the Mississippi Valley heading south out of Columbia, Illinois, with views of the bluffs as we support our adopted heroes. Get involved, give, and meet our heroes!

Difficulty Level:  4Ab

The JCS Bike for Heroes ride offers five different routes in distances with a group start time at 7:30 A.M.

  • Purple Heart Route: approximately 10 miles
  • Red Route: approximately 25 miles
  • White Route: approximately 50 miles
  • Blue Route: approximately 80 miles
  • Blue Route with Bronze Star Century: approximately 100 miles
